2023 is going to be a busy year for the aespa girls.
Following the release of the K-POP group’s third mini-album in May, my worldThe quartet, consisting of Carina, Gisele, Ninning and Winter, has announced its first global tour later this year, covering the US, Latin America and Europe. To get ready for the trip, the girl group took to the main stage at the Governors Ball Music Festival at New York City’s Flushing Meadows Corona Park on Saturday (June 10), and despite being one less member, the girl group took the biggest hits. released a hit song.
Ahead of aespa’s Gov Ball performance, they made history as the first K-pop artists to grace the festival, but the group’s management company SM Entertainment confirmed that Gisele did not attend the festival. MYs (the group’s fan name) and released a statement. Festival.
“We would like to inform all aespa fans in the United States that Gisele will not be able to attend the upcoming Governors Ball due to health issues,” the statement said.
Karina, Ninning and Winter, who followed as soldiers, commanded the stage with their unparalleled presence and opened the set with a few nods to the group’s extensive and intriguing legend. Leading the intro is Naevis, an AI system that helps the girls’ digital avatars appear in the real world, before the trio kick off with an energetic performance of “Girls” accompanied by fiery fireworks to rouse the crowd.
